Essential Functions/Examples of Work
Under the direct supervision of the Call Center Coordinator, the individual in this classification functions as a customer service representative in the performance of technical and paraprofessional work in the dissemination of information regarding the Missouri Consolidated Health Care Plan. The Benefit Counselor functions as a telephone liaison between health plans and members; responding accurately and promptly, both verbally and in writing, to incoming inquiries regarding topics such as claims payment, eligibility, membership in various managed care plans and a variety of other questions. Other duties include establishing a good rapport with members, potential members and providers; working within and outside the office to resolve member problems; maintaining accurate and detailed telephone logs; handling returned mail; and performing other duties as needed or assigned.
